Overview of Icici Prudential ELSS Fund
The Icici Prudential Equity Linked Savings Scheme (ELSS) stands as a prominent choice for investors seeking tax benefits alongside potential capital appreciation.
The fund objectives focus on long-term growth through equity investments, targeting a mix of large-cap and mid-cap stocks.
However, investors must consider inherent risk factors, including market volatility and sector concentration, which could impact returns and overall investment performance.
